Vanessa Lee of The Things We Do Spills K-Beauty Tips After Jetting Off to Korea With Kim and Khloé Kardashian


Girls trip goals! Vanessa Lee of The Things We Do enjoyed a Korean getaway — courtesy of Kim Air — with Kim and Khloé Kardashian, La La Anthony, and more, and now, the skincare expert is spilling the beauty intel she picked up overseas.

“Korea is known for their innovation in cosmetic and plastic surgery procedures and prioritizes efficiency and quality. … I always like to go straight to the source of where professionals are mastering their techniques,” she tells ET.

In 2018, the medical aesthetic provider received thread training from Korean providers ahead of opening her own beauty studios, and earlier this year, she visited the country to try out the PicoSure Pro laser and Jeuveau neurotoxin before bringing them to her locations.

As for this time around? Lee got to test out fresh treatments, plus share top advice with her fellow travelers. 

“I had the opportunity to guide the girls with my expertise. … This trip was about getting a little more invasive for me. … Korea’s hyperpigmentation technologies, body tightening devices, and biostimulator skin boosters have been on my to-do list.”

Some of her favorites: “I loved the Onda body tightening treatment using microwave technology and want to introduce stacking PicoSure with Vivace for maximum skin rejuvenation, as well and to start embossing PRFM into the skin for more superficial support.”

If you are just diving into the K-Beauty trends, the cosmetic RN recommends getting started with staples from Korean pharmacies. 

“I love Noscarna for scar reduction, Rejuall PDRN for barrier building and strength, and zinc and pineapple enzyme jellies and powders for internal healing,” she shares.

And even if you’re already a pro, there’s always newness to explore.

“I experienced a variety of more advanced procedures firsthand and studied their potential for our patients and Kim learned about beauty and business for SKIMS. It was so much fun and was a girls’ trip for the books,” Lee says.
